Equinix Inc. closed 15.37% below its 52-week high of $994.03, which the company reached on November 27th.
Equinix Inc. closed 13.95% below its 52-week high of $994.03, which the company reached on November 27th.
Some results have been hidden because they may be inaccessible to you
Show inaccessible results